Discover more about Castle of the Three Dragons

The Castle of the Three Dragons, located in the picturesque Jardins Fontserè i Mestre in Ciutat Vella, is a striking example of Catalan modernisme architecture. Designed by the renowned architect Lluís Domènech i Montaner, this iconic structure was originally built for the 1888 Universal Exposition and has since become a cherished part of Barcelona's cultural landscape. As a museum, it houses fascinating exhibits that delve into various aspects of natural sciences and biology, making it a captivating destination for visitors of all ages. Surrounded by lush gardens, the castle is not only an architectural marvel but also a tranquil oasis amidst the bustling city. The gardens themselves, with their vibrant flora and serene pathways, provide an ideal setting for a leisurely stroll or a quiet moment of reflection.
